簡單網路管理通訊協定(SNMP)是一種網路管理通訊協定,有助於記錄、儲存和共用網路中裝置的資訊。這有助於管理員解決網路問題。SNMP使用管理資訊庫(MIB)以分層方式儲存可用資訊。
SNMP使用者由登入憑證(如使用者名稱、密碼和身份驗證方法)定義。它與SNMP組和引擎ID相關聯地操作。有關如何通過命令列介面(CLI)配置SNMP組的說明,請按一下此處。只有SNMPv3使用SNMP使用者。具有訪問許可權的使用者與SNMP檢視相關聯。
例如,網路管理員可以配置SNMP使用者以將它們關聯到某個組,以便可以將訪問許可權分配給該特定組中的一組使用者,而不是分配給單個使用者。一個使用者只能屬於一個組。要建立SNMPv3使用者,必須配置引擎ID,並且SNMPv3組必須可用。
本文旨在展示如何通過Cisco交換機的CLI配置SNMP使用者。
步驟 1.存取交換器的CLI。
注意:在本示例中,PuTTY是用於訪問交換機CLI的應用程式。預設的使用者名稱和密碼是 cisco/cisco。如果您已自定義您的憑據,請使用使用者名稱和密碼。
步驟 2.通過輸入以下命令切換到全域性配置模式:
步驟 3.使用以下語法建立引擎ID:
snmp-server engineID local {engineid/default}
注意:引擎ID在您的管理域內必須是唯一的。在本示例中,輸入了snmp-server engineID local 57AD57AD57AD。
步驟 4.使用以下語法新增SNMP使用者:
snmp-server user username groupname {{v1/v2c/remote host/auth {{md5/sha}} auth-password [priv priv-password] ]}
其中:
注意:在本示例中,輸入的是snmp-server使用者John_Doe CiscoTesters v3 auth md5 Cisco1234$。
步驟 5.使用以下命令驗證SNMP使用者:
現在,您應該已經通過交換機的CLI配置了SNMP使用者。
修訂 | 發佈日期 | 意見 |
---|---|---|
1.0 |
13-Dec-2018 |
初始版本 |